曲柄摇杆机构运动学matlab仿真
时间: 2023-12-25 07:01:20 浏览: 238
曲柄摇杆机构是一种常见的机械运动机构,常用于发动机和泵等设备中。运动学是研究机构各个连杆运动规律的学科,通过matlab仿真可以对曲柄摇杆机构进行运动学分析。
首先,我们需要建立曲柄摇杆机构的数学模型,包括连杆的长度、连杆的连接位置、曲柄和摇杆的夹角等参数。然后,利用matlab进行编程,建立运动学仿真模型,输入参数并模拟机构的运动规律。
在仿真过程中,可以分析曲柄摇杆机构的运动规律,如曲柄和摇杆的角速度、角加速度,连接杆的位置和速度等。还可以通过改变参数,如曲柄和摇杆的长度、夹角等,来观察对机构运动规律的影响。
通过matlab仿真,我们可以深入了解曲柄摇杆机构的运动特性,为设计和优化机构提供参考。此外,仿真还可以帮助工程师在设计阶段发现潜在的问题,比如运动不稳定、碰撞等,并及时进行调整和改进。
总之,利用matlab进行曲柄摇杆机构的运动学仿真可以帮助我们更好地理解机构的运动规律,为工程设计提供重要参考。
相关问题
matlab对曲柄摇杆机构运动分析
Matlab是一种强大的数值计算和图形处理工具,对于工程学和机械设计中的复杂系统分析,包括曲柄摇杆机构的运动分析,提供了丰富的功能。曲柄摇杆机构是一种常见的机械传动结构,分析其运动通常涉及到动力学、几何学和运动学。
在Matlab中,你可以使用以下步骤进行曲柄摇杆机构的运动分析:
1. **模型建立**:首先,你需要定义机构的各个部分(如连杆、曲柄、摇杆)的长度和位置参数,并可能需要创建一个几何模型来表示它们。
2. **坐标系选择**:确定适合的坐标系,比如极坐标系统,其中通常一个轴是沿着摇杆或曲柄的方向,另一个轴可能是垂直于摇杆的。
3. **运动学方程**:利用矢量力学的知识,编写或调用Matlab的符号计算工具(如`syms`或`solve`),来求解机构的速度和加速度方程。
4. **仿真与动画**:使用Matlab的图形库(如`ode45`进行数值积分)和可视化工具(如`animate`)来模拟机构的运动,观察关键点(如铰链点、死点等)的行为。
5. **分析性能指标**:计算如最大角速度、周期、冲程等关键性能参数,并可能对机构的稳定性进行评估。
阅读全文